Seekh kabab is a starter made with minced or ground meat, onion, lemon, coriander leaves and some Indian spices....
Seekh kabab is a starter u can mostly find in parties, function etc. It is cooked in tandoor or barbecue....if you don't have this thing it is better to go with tawa. To give the flavour of tandoor you can heat the charcoal and keep it in between the seekh kabab and close it with one plate. This will give you smoky feeling and really it tastes good. PREPARATION TIME : 5 MINS
COOKING TIME :20 MINS
MARINATION TIME :30-40 MINS
INGREDIENTS
- 200gm minced mutton
- 1/4 tsp ginger garlic paste
- Pepper a pinch
- 1/4 tsp garam masala
- 1/2 tsp red chilli powder
- 1/4 tsp coriander powder
- 1/2 onion chopped
- 2 tsp coriander leaves
- 1 tbsp besan/gram flour
- Salt to taste
- 1 Lemon
- 1/4 tsp ghee
- 2 tsp oil
- Skewer
METHOD
Take a bowl and mix all ingredients minced mutton, ginger garlic paste, pepper, garam masala, red chilli powder, coriander powder, onion coriander leaves, gram flour, salt, lemon and ghee and mix it well with the help of hands (u can also add green chillies and egg if u want)
keep it in the refrigerator for about 30-40 minutes. After it is marinated mix it nicely
Heat one tawa add some oil. And take a small portion of it and start making the cylindrical shape and skewer it
Add seekh kabab on tawa and cook it from all the side
After it is done from all the side heat one charcoal and keep it in seekh kabab's plate and add some oil on it to get smoke from charcoal and close it for 5 minutes.
Squeeze some lemon above the seekh kabab and serve it with lemon wedges
